Transaction 78406524439d51b6678d141c29a4e08767afc70d229126ff5a3a10cb4f1afca8
1 Input
2 Outputs
- 78406524439d51b6678d141c29a4e08767afc70d229126ff5a3a10cb4f1afca8:0
- 78406524439d51b6678d141c29a4e08767afc70d229126ff5a3a10cb4f1afca8:1
value 3644
address 19TMAhvYBHkiVTMr8PFMATcu3nGojWBu5q
value 25000
address 3GmKZNFdsKqivJagjyhvE77qevSttPBENj